By reacting primary and secondary amines with 2,4-bis(4-methoxyphenyl)-1,3,2,4-dithiadiphosphetane-2,4-disulfide, 1A, at 25° ammonium 4-methoxyphenylphosphonamidodithioates, 2, are formed. Upon heating to 140° 2 eliminates hydrogen sulfide in a new type of reaction yielding 4-methoxyphenylphosphonothioic diamides, 3, which also are formed directly from primary amines and 1A at 140°. 通过使伯胺和仲胺与2,4-双(4-甲氧基苯基)-1,3,2,4-二硫代二磷杂环戊烷-2,4-二硫化物1A在25°下反应,形成4-甲氧基苯基膦酰胺基二硫代铵2。加热至140° 2后,在新型反应中消除了硫化氢,生成了4-甲氧基苯基膦硫基二酰胺3,它也直接由伯胺和1A在140°形成。对于二苄胺,由于N→S重排反应,观察到一些异常结果。给出了化合物2和3的NMR光谱数据。
